How about prices in Thailand ? I don't know if it's compared to things in U.S. but I feel cheaper than in Japan. You can have something to eat around 50 Baht (1.5 dollars). About fruits, it depends on the kind or how fresh but 1kg is 30 to 40 Baht (about 1 dollar).

Cost of living in Thailand is 36.15% lower than in United States (aggregate data for all cities, rent is not taken into account). Rent in Thailand is 61.00% lower than in United States (average data for all cities). Money and costs in Thailand - Lonely Planet Most places in Thailand deal only with cash. Some foreign credit cards are accepted in high-end establishments. Tipping is not generally expected in Thailand, though it is appreciated. It doesn’t always happen this way, but in Bangkok the hotel seasons match the dry and rainy seasons exactly. For mid-range and high-end hotels, the high season in Bangkok is from November through April, and many also have a peak season during the Christmas and New Year’s holiday period.
